The only pitfall here is most courses are not much related to each other, so Udacity is probably not your starting point, but a virtual university to further your study. How should you even get started practicing this stuff? It features mini-quizzes and technical challenges that mimic the real world.

Cool, rebound dating sie but nothing yet looks like to a Tetris gaming piece. The interval period is given in milliseconds. There are two ways to resolve that.

In the game loop we just call the moveBox function that moves the box in each frame. One huge let-down will be the shortage of hints, answers and forum, so you are probably doomed if you fail to solve any one of the quizzes, just like old times. Flexbox Froggy Flexbox Froggy is one of the most unique ways to learn flexbox another one is listed below. Any editor of your choice to write the code.

We follow creating the velocity properties. The source code for the entire project is also freely accessible on the GitHub repo. This function makes a given function to be called in given periodic intervals. Add a reference to this script file in default. It is a series of instructions that are repeated until an event triggers the end of the game.

We summarize what a game loop is in the pseudo-code presented below. But this visual explorer webapp is still a fun and interactive way to conceptually understand flexbox.

Your only job is to understand why and how. You can first join the Programming Basics course to watch and learn basic concepts, then explore the given code after the video tutorial to validate your doubts. LearnStreet adopts command prompt-styled code interpreters with human language to explain function and encourage you whenever possible, the kind of command prompt you want for your own local machine.

With Khan Academy, you can save your modification as a Spin-Off for everyone to enjoy and customize. You should have as a result a black region with a small white box inside it. The very first aim was to be able to create a Tetris-like game in an easy way! Luckily, there are hints and answers to refer to. It does not preach any specific programming language, but the code pattern it adopts can be applied anywhere, as a majority of languages share the similar programming pattern.

If you buy something we get a small commission at no extra charge to you. Inside each lesson is a panel that explains necessary code and instruction. But this is unfortunately not yet the case.

In this tutorial you will learn the concept of the Game Loop and will apply this concept to build a simple animation. You also get to play with the code, then see the impact of the changes immediately.

The video below shows what you will accomplish at the end of the tutorial. At the end of each lesson you also get to play a mini game to release your cumulated stress, and keep you going for longer. The Tetris grid gaming grid is composed of squares. It plants a solid concept of programming and the way it solves the problem systematically in your mind.

The traditional method is to write code locally, then compile your. The animation is run only after the document is completely loaded. We create it using the setInterval function.